Privacy Lead Duties: Serve as the privacy subject matter expert at on Personal Data, Consumer Information and Seller Data. Be responsible for helping our teams understand how to handle sensitive information. Partner with outside counsel to monitor and interpret the various data privacy laws, regulations, contractual obligations and industry best practices relating to data privacy. Develop and enhance the existing program, policies, procedures and guidance for data privacy to continually improve our compliance. Work closely with product engineering to ensure that all products comply with data privacy requirements. Oversee, develop and deliver ongoing data privacy training to all employees. Advise business leaders on data privacy requirements relating to the design, marketing and delivery of products and services. Collaborate with International stakeholders in order to develop privacy programs tailored specifically for local countries. Embed privacy and data compliance into the company’s culture, addressing all aspects necessary for best practices compliance program, including training, communication and monitoring/auditing. Partner with InfoSec team to investigate and report on any data incidents. Work with the Compliance, Trust & Safety and InfoSec teams to scope and perform periodic data privacy risk assessments, mitigation and remediation, including data control design and monitoring, as well as the mitigation of privacy and security risks. Maintain documentation and reporting on Square’s privacy programs. Advise commercial legal teams and serving as an escalation path in the negotiation of privacy aspects of customer agreements.
Qualification and Experience
Qualifications: Bachelor’s degree and JD Degree required, along with a license to practice law in California. lAPP Certifications such as CIPP/US, CIPP/IT and/or CIPP/M a plus. 8+ years of experience in a role focused on data privacy compliance. Extensive knowledge in U.S. state and federal data privacy laws. In-depth knowledge and experience on building and maintaining privacy programs and/or controls is required. Deep understanding of U.S. and International privacy laws (including HIPAA), regulations and best practices. Strong technical knowledge to effectively partner with our engineering, InfoSec and product teams. Experience and skill at writing policies and guidance documents supporting various business activities and conducting investigations. Demonstrated ability to learn quickly, prioritize multiple urgent tasks, and deliver results in a fast-paced environment with extremely tight deadlines. Strong knowledge and interest in emerging technologies and especially fintech. Ability to influence and drive projects to conclusion. Impeccable ethics and judgement. Team oriented and able to build strong cross-functional relationships.
